Изменения документа Ошибки

Редактировал(а) Alexandr Fokin 2023/12/16 14:12

<
От версии < 1.16 >
отредактировано Alexandr Fokin
на 2023/05/21 09:51
К версии < 1.14 >
отредактировано Alexandr Fokin
на 2023/01/12 14:53
>
Изменить комментарий: К данной версии нет комментариев

Комментарий

Подробности

Свойства страницы
Содержимое
... ... @@ -8,23 +8,15 @@
8 8  READ COMMITTED
9 9  REPEATABLE READ
10 10  SERIALIZABLE
11 -|(% colspan="1" rowspan="2" style="width:143px" %)[[PostgreSQL>>doc:Разработка.Базы данных.SQL.PostgreSQL.WebHome]]|(% style="width:90px" %)55P03|(% style="width:746px" %)Ошибка получения блокировки (ожидания разблокировки) данных.
12 -Не является полноценным Deadlock, поэтому не разрешается механизмом прерывания сервера БД.
13 -Зависит от параметра lock_timeout (может иметь значение - бесконечно) и от таймаута запроса.
14 -Не разрешается пока один из запросов не завершиться успешно или же упадет по одному из таймаутов и снимет блокировку, чтобы второй мог продолжится.|(% style="width:558px" %)READ COMMITTED
15 -REPEATABLE READ
16 -SERIALIZABLE
17 -|(% style="width:90px" %)40P01|(% style="width:746px" %)Полноценный Deadlock, прерывается сервером БД.
18 -Сервер БД завершает одну из взаимоблокирующих транзакций с ошибкой.|(% style="width:558px" %)READ COMMITTED
19 -REPEATABLE READ
20 -SERIALIZABLE
21 -|(% colspan="1" style="width:143px" %) |(% style="width:90px" %)40001|(% style="width:746px" %)(((
11 +|(% colspan="1" rowspan="2" style="width:143px" %)[[PostgreSQL>>doc:Разработка.Базы данных.SQL.PostgreSQL.WebHome]]|(% style="width:90px" %)40001|(% style="width:746px" %)(((
22 22  Ошибка сериализации.
23 23  Транзакция не может быть продолжена из-за того, что необходимые данные были изменены другой транзакцией.
24 24  
25 25  13.5. Serialization Failure Handling
26 26  [[https:~~/~~/www.postgresql.org/docs/current/mvcc-serialization-failure-handling.html>>https://www.postgresql.org/docs/current/mvcc-serialization-failure-handling.html]]
27 -
28 -[[Оптимистичная блокировка>>doc:Архитектура и модели.Блокировки.Оптимистичная блокировка.WebHome]]
29 29  )))|(% style="width:558px" %)REPEATABLE READ
30 30  SERIALIZABLE
19 +|(% style="width:90px" %)40P01|(% style="width:746px" %)Полноценный Deadlock, прерывается сервером БД.
20 +Сервер БД завершает одну из взаимоблокирующих транзакций с ошибкой.|(% style="width:558px" %)READ COMMITTED
21 +REPEATABLE READ
22 +SERIALIZABLE